TUBIFAST FIXATION / RETENTION DRESSINGS

These products fixate or retain dressings or protect fragile skin. A fixation can be self-adhesive and may or may not have the Safetac® technology. It can also be a tubular or a flat retention bandage.

FIXATION / RETENTION - TUBIFAST™ WITH 2-WAY STRETCH TECHNOLOGY®

Mölnlycke HealthCare’s New Tubifast™ 2-Way Stretch Technology® is the world’s first and only lightweight elasticated tubular bandage with radial and longitudinal stretch ideal for dressing fixation and skin covering for any part of the body. The high-tech bandage can also be used for patch wrapping and as an under-cast stockinette. It is quick and easy to use, with less risk of fraying than traditional tubular bandages.

Features and details

Unique technology holds dressings securely, without constriction or compression and without the need for tapes, pins or ties. Tubifast with 2-Way Stretch Technology is manufactured from rayon with very fine elastane threads knitted into the fabric to provide light elasticity. It holds dressings securely, without constriction or compression. Its light elasticity allows patients complete freedom of movement. The light, open weave fabric allows air to circulate over the skin, helping to avoid maceration.

Areas of use

Because of its tubular construction, Tubifast with 2-Way Stretch Technology is particularly suitable for holding dressings in place on difficult areas such as stumps of amputee patients. No pins or tapes are necessary to retain Tubifast 2-Way Stretch.

How to use Tubifast 2-Way Stretch

1. Choose the correct width bandage, using  the quick reference color coding, and cut to length.
2. Stretch Tubifast 2-Way Stretch over the affected area.
3. Position Tubifast 2-Way Stretch to cover the dressing. Illustrated, step-by-step instructions are available for more advanced applications.
